General Mach Discussion / Re: Plasma Torch Start Macro
« on: July 08, 2015, 09:50:43 PM »
First you are going to have trouble FINDING the TOM(top of material) without Z axis control. THAT is assuming you don't have a Z.

Set up the ouputs to activate the air cylinder and torch on
Setup the input for arckOK signal (THCon)

Set up the M3 to activate the signals for air cylinder(lower torch), then activate the the Torchon signal.


Your gcode would be

G0 X10 Y10  ( move to cut start point()
M3  (lower cylinder and  torchON )
G4P1  ( pierce dwell)
G1 X20  (start cutting
etc
etc
M5  (torch off, raise torch)

When you have THCon turned on Mach3 senses for an arkOK signal, when found it allow Mach3 to start motion. IF you loose ArcOK it stops.

YOu can set up the rotary cutter as M4.

Mach4 General Discussion / Re: Line following (tracing)
« on: July 04, 2015, 12:44:34 PM »
Yes it can be done automatically or manually. In auto mode you need a plugin to interface the Camera Scanner (like Scan Anything) to M4. In manual mode you need a Wizard like CopyCatM4 to do the the line,arc,circle,drill point acquisition. Then you can auto convert to either a Gcode or a DXF file
IT can be done in many different ways.

It sounds as if you have very slow acceleration/deaccelleration. THAT would explain the long overtravel to a stop when homing.  ALSO you may have to set a debounce to account for any switch bounce?? Best to fix the switch problem but debounce can help in testing.

IF when homing you get a switch bounce it automatically will set back to limit and IF there is another make of the switch (rebound) it will trip the limit.
